You have to start with a perfectly smooth surface area to wind up with perfectly painted walls or woodwork. One pro tells PM that Sander would be a more fitting job title than Painter given that he invests so much time pressing sandpaper. Sanding levels outs spackle or joint-compound spots and flattens ridges around nail holes. Sanding likewise removes burrs and rough areas in your trim.
